Starting out the show with a joke track. No. Check that. It’s a track that started out as a joke, and then morphed into something wonderful. Start at the beginning. John Darnielle of The Mountain Goats was joking around on twitter with Rian Johnson, who is directing the new Star Wars movie. He suggested a song titled: The Ultimate Jedi Who Wastes All The Other Jedi And Eats Their Bones. Rian replied to John: PLEASE WRITE THIS. And so he did.

Hour two of the show started as a discussion about RJD2’s Deadringer album. What grew out of it was a whole lot of nostalgia for yours truly. A little angry hip-hop, some electronic music, some rock, some weirdness. There were politicians that I disagreed with. The state of the world felt poor.

Thank goodness for Definitive Jux, brainchild of El-Producto & Amaechi Uzoigwe. Def Jux is how I first heard Aesop Rock, Cannibal Ox, RJD2 and El-P. (No, I had not heard of Company Flow at the time.)

I am pretty sure that I first heard of Beth Orton on the Chemical Brothers’ Exit Planet Dust. As far as her solo work, I remember hearing Daybreaker before Central Reservation. I would have to dig out some mix CDs from the time to be sure.

But Doves. Oh man, Doves. I was so in love with that band. Ladytron, too. Both groups put out their second albums in 2002. Neither suffered from the sophomore slump. Who else? Throw in some Idlewild, Decemberists, and Trail Of Dead, and you take me back to a lot of live shows from that year.
